Chile - General Government Expenditures on Environment Protection

Since 2013, Chile General Government Expenditures on Environment Protection increased 4.5% year on year. At $830.17 Million PPP in 2016, the country was ranked number 25 among other countries in General Government Expenditures on Environment Protection. Chile is overtaken by Denmark, which was number 24 at $1,280.49 Million PPP and is followed by Luxembourg with $626.67 Million PPP. Japan lead the ranking with $63,096.86 Million PPP in 2019, that is a growth of 1.1% versus 2018. France, Germany and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Colombia witnessed the best average annual growth at +11.6% per year, while Hungary was the worst growing country at -13.7% per year.
